Alcohol is its own macronutrient and an "empty" calorie which leaves us with little nutrient value.
There are 7 calories per gram of ethanol, and when it's present in the body, lipolysis - our fat burning process is inhibited while the body metabolises the alcohol.
This doesn't meant you can't lose fat, it just means it has to be factored into your total daily intake. And For fatloss to occur you must be in negative energy balance.
Just like you track all your other macronutrients, you need to track the calories in your alcohol because let me tell you they add up.
1 standard shot of vodka is 97 calories .
You can take calories from either fat (9cal per gram) or carbohydrates (4cal per gram) to fit into your daily macros.
If I took those 97 calories and divided it by 4 that would mean I would have to deduct about 25g away from my carbs.
If I had 4 standard drinks with vodka in them, that's 100g of carbs and almost 400 calories. (That's not even including the calories from other ingredients in cocktails.
Thats pretty significant.
That's literally a whole meal. Personally I'd prefer to eat those carbs, but there's a time and a place for a drink or too.
You can lose fat while and have a drink, It just needs to be factored into your calorie budget.
